WebJun 30, 2024 · An LLC bank account is a separate bank account for your limited liability company. It is important to have a separate account for your business so that you can prove that you and your business are separate financial entities in the event of a lawsuit or large liability. Hired to support the entire bank footprint and tasked with ... grooms speech thanking the in lawsWebMay 7, 2024 · Managing LLC Capital Contributions. Members are required to contribute capital to an LLC only in the amounts they agree to contribute in the Operating Agreement, at the times specified in the Operating Agreement.
